According to Nivo News, the incident occurred in the early hours of Sunday, January 4, 2026, leaving critical sections of the police facility completely destroyed.

Video footage circulating online captured the moment flames engulfed the Mopol 13 premises, showing the office buildings and armoury reduced to rubble as the fire raged through the facility. The extent of the destruction was evident, with key operational areas consumed by the inferno.

In the footage, a distressed voice describing the scene lamented that the armoury had been completely burnt, noting that nothing was salvaged from the fire. The narrator further claimed that the Squadron Commander’s office was also affected, stating that virtually all sections of the unit were destroyed by the blaze.

As of the time of filing this report, the cause of the fire had not been officially determined. Authorities were yet to confirm whether the outbreak was caused by an electrical fault or any other factor, while investigations were expected to commence to ascertain the circumstances surrounding the incident.
